Moreover, I discovered the human element in cybersecurity, which is often

the weakest link. Social engineering attacks, where cybercriminals

manipulate people into divulging sensitive information, are a stark

reminder that security is not just about technology but also about

awareness and education. This realization led me to advocate for

cybersecurity education within my school, emphasizing the importance of

safe online practices and the need for vigilance.

In terms of proactive measures, I believe that a combination of

technological solutions and user education is crucial. For instance, I have

personally adopted the habit of regularly updating my software to patch

any security vulnerabilities. I also make it a point to use strong, unique

passwords for each of my online accounts and enable twofactor

authentication wherever possible.

Furthermore, I have learned the importance of backing up data regularly to

mitigate the risks associated with data loss due to cyberattacks or hardware failure. This practice ensures that even if my information system

is compromised, I have a safety net to fall back on.
